Output 9b00a04fe90026433b4b206c98061248f6b7e4f6e8ea0669c2fc666e1f1897ab:5

value
2674578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e58958dd1491fd7acacbec75858339a0ca9d8ee6 OP_EQUAL
address
3NchCX216wzzByZoPLLgg8mdusWvWs84ow
transaction
9b00a04fe90026433b4b206c98061248f6b7e4f6e8ea0669c2fc666e1f1897ab
spent
true